Day 1: Visit the Torres of Torres del Paine
Meals: Lunch and Dinner
Hike: Puerto Natales – Refugio Chileno
In the morning, you will leave Puerto Natales heading towards Torres del Paine National Park. After arriving in the park, you will begin to casually walk up Almirante Nieto, a mountain that takes you to an incredible view of Lake Nordenskjold and the Asencio Valley.
You will arrive at Refugio Chileno a few hours after lunch. This is where you will be spending the night, so you will check into the refugio and leave your things there, before continuing on the hike. After a short rest in Chileno, you will hike one hour through a dense Lenga forest. After leaving the forest, you will approach a moraine and climb to see the amazing granite peaks known as the Torres. After a bit of time admiring the view you will return back to Chileno to have dinner and sleep.
Day 2: Hike along Lake Nordenskjold
Meals: Breakfast, Lunch and Dinner
Hike: Refugio Chileno – Refugio Cuernos
You will have breakfast in the morning before then heading off to hike again. You will set off from Refugio Chileno and walk for around four hours toward Refugio Cuernos, which is located on the coast of Lake Nordenskjold and the foot of the impressive Cuernos of Paine.
On the way, you will border Almirante Nieto and pass by Lake Nordenskjold. You will have a few rivers to cross by hopping across rocks and also catch views of glaciers upon the mountain tops that are hovering over you. Finally you see the Cuernos! They are monstrous peaks, you will spend the night at the foot of them in Refugio Cuernos after a breathtaking journey.
Day 3: Explore the French Valley
Meals: Breakfast, Lunch and Dinner
Hike: Refugio Cuernos – Refugio Paine Grande
Just after breakfast you will begin the hike toward Camp Italiano. This camp is just two and a half easy hours away. The trek begins on a windy beach but you will eventually escape into the valley and find that the wind is a little calmer
You will leave your backpack at Camp Italiano once you arrive there and continue into the French Valley with just a small day pack. You will hike across a moraine and through a forest until you finally arrived at a clearing. Whilst the wind will be very strong here, you will be blown away even more by the spectacular views of Lake Nordenskjold, Skottberg and Pehoe behind you. Ahead of you, you will be able to see the shocking hanging glacier called the French Glacier, as well as many of the peaks that are the reason why this park has become famous. After leaving the lookout, you will return to gather your backpacks and continue to Refugio Paine Grande where you will spend the night.
Day 4: Admire Glacier Grey
Meals: Breakfast, Lunch and Dinner
Hike: Refugio Paine Grande – Glacier Grey
After a restful night’s sleep and an energizing breakfast, you will be ready to hike again. Today you will hike a short two hours up through a small forest to the first lookout of Grey Glacier. You will be able to experience the wind coming off the Southern Ice Field and see both the ice field and Glacier Grey!
You will continue walking for 2 more hours until finally reaching Refugio Grey, which is tucked away in a small valley in a wooded area that is protected from the wind. You will check into the refugio and then have time to continue towards Glacier Grey. If you like you can get up close to the Glacier at Camp Guardas or you can rest along the beach. You will return to Refugio Grey for dinner and a warm bed. (You can also opt for additional excursions in the afternoon or morning while staying in Refugio Grey — see “Additional Extras” below.)
Day 5: Return to Puerto Natales
Meals: Breakfast and Lunch
Hike: Glacier Grey – Puerto Natales
After four days hiking on the famous Torres del Paine W Trek, you will have the morning to walk around Glacier Grey. You will board the Grey III boat in the afternoon. You will enjoy your afternoon by admiring the glacier from up-close and take remarkable photographs of the surroundings. Just after 16:00 hrs you will begin your journey towards Puerto Natales and on to your next adventure!
